Like I said to my best mate, Oli, I want there to be songs on the album that I could play to your mum, and she could listen to it and take something away from it. Maybe she doesn’t love the song, but lyrically she’ll understand something about me. This is something that – for me, anyway – it doesn’t feel like we have enough of. A lot of artists use words because they sound nice, or because it works for the science of the song. Again, that’s why bands like Arctic Monkeys are so great. They don’t work on any script or any maths or science. They just say what they feel. If it doesn’t rhyme, it doesn’t matter. If it sounds awkward, it doesn’t matter. I think, especially with being lucky enough to have a big fanbase, I want to say to them, “Look, lyrics actually matter, and I want to show you why”.
